Nov 7, 2025Complaint
Clean

This report details the findings of a Complaint Investigation conducted on 11/07/2025, stemming from an initial complaint received on 08/04/2023. The investigation reviewed allegations including neglect, unsanitary conditions, and staff conduct. Based on the evidence reviewed, the department determined that the allegations were UNSUBSTANTIATED.

Oct 10, 2025Other
Clean

The facility underwent an unannounced annual continuation inspection. The Licensing Program Analyst observed that staff records were complete, required certifications (CPR, First Aid) were current, and safety precautions were in place. No deficiencies were cited during this visit.

Sep 24, 2025Other
Clean

The inspection revealed multiple critical deficiencies across several areas, including medication storage, facility safety (obstructed passageways), and failure to meet specific resident medical care requirements. All cited deficiencies were classified as Type A, indicating an immediate and direct risk to the health, safety, or personal rights of the residents in care. The facility was required to take immediate corrective action for these serious violations.

Sep 19, 2025Other
Clean

The inspection identified one deficiency related to operating beyond the licensed capacity. Specifically, the facility admitted a resident, exceeding its licensed limit of 21 persons. This violation is classified as Type A due to the immediate risk posed to the residents' health and safety.

Sep 18, 2025Other
Clean

The unannounced case management visit investigated a resident's hospitalization due to an apparent medication overdose. Two Type A deficiencies were cited, indicating immediate risks to resident health and safety. Specifically, the facility failed to protect the resident from unauthorized medication access and did not immediately call 9-1-1 during the medical emergency.
